Josephine E. Tildjen. American Algae 65. Porphyrosiphon notarisii Kg. Tab. Phyc. 2:7. 1850—52. Filaments firmly glued together into a flat, slippery coating. Diameter of filaments without sheath 20 mik., cell contents deep golden yellow, sheath colorless, lamellose, at the ends shredded out into fibrillae. Growing in damp sand in stone quarry. Minneapolis, Minnesota. Coll. A. P. Anderson, 7 Ag. 1894. 02348048
